| getProperty |
|---|
public any getProperty( string propertyName, [any defaultValue=""] )
Returns the property value by name. If the property is not defined, and a default value is passed, it will be returned. If the property and a default value are both not defined then an exception is thrown.
Parameters:
| string propertyName |
| [any defaultValue=""] |
Code:
<cffunction name="getProperty" access="public" returntype="any" output="false" hint="Returns the property value by name. If the property is not defined, and a default value is passed, it will be returned. If the property and a default value are both not defined then an exception is thrown."> <cfargument name="propertyName" type="string" required="true" hint="The name of the property to return." /> <cfargument name="defaultValue" type="any" required="false" default="" hint="The default value to use if the requested property is not defined." /> <cfif isPropertyDefined(arguments.propertyName)> <cfreturn variables.properties[arguments.propertyName] /> <cfelseif IsObject(getParent()) AND getParent().isPropertyDefined(arguments.propertyName)> <cfreturn getParent().getProperty(arguments.propertyName)> <cfelseif StructKeyExists(arguments, "defaultValue")> <cfreturn arguments.defaultValue /> <cfelse> <cfthrow type="MachII.framework.PropertyNotDefined" message="Property with name '#arguments.propertyName#' is not defined." /> </cfif> </cffunction>

| loadXml |
|---|
public void loadXml( string configXML, [boolean override="false"] )
Loads xml into the manager.
Parameters:
| string configXML |
| [boolean override="false"] |
Code:
<cffunction name="loadXml" access="public" returntype="void" output="false"
hint="Loads xml into the manager.">
<cfargument name="configXML" type="string" required="true" />
<cfargument name="override" type="boolean" required="false" default="false" />
<cfset var propertyNodes = ArrayNew(1) />
<cfset var propertyName = "" />
<cfset var propertyValue = "" />
<cfset var propertyType = "" />
<cfset var propertyParams = "" />
<cfset var paramsNodes = ArrayNew(1) />
<cfset var paramName = "" />
<cfset var paramValue = "" />
<cfset var hasParent = IsObject(getParent()) />
<cfset var mapping = "" />
<cfset var i = 0 />
<cfset var j = 0 />
<cfif NOT arguments.override>
<cfset propertyNodes = XMLSearch(arguments.configXML, "mach-ii/properties/property") />
<cfelse>
<cfset propertyNodes = XMLSearch(arguments.configXML, ".//properties/property") />
</cfif>
<cfloop from="1" to="#ArrayLen(PropertyNodes)#" index="i">
<cfset propertyName = propertyNodes[i].xmlAttributes["name"] />
<cfif hasParent AND arguments.override AND StructKeyExists(propertyNodes[i].xmlAttributes, "overrideAction")>
<cfif propertyNodes[i].xmlAttributes["overrideAction"] EQ "useParent">
<cfset removeProperty(propertyName) />
<cfelseif propertyNodes[i].xmlAttributes["overrideAction"] EQ "addFromParent">
<cfif StructKeyExists(propertyNodes[i].xmlAttributes, "mapping")>
<cfset mapping = propertyNodes[i].xmlAttributes["mapping"] />
<cfelse>
<cfset mapping = propertyName />
</cfif>
<cfif NOT getParent().isPropertyDefined(mapping)>
<cfthrow type="MachII.framework.overridePropertyNotDefined"
message="An property named '#mapping#' cannot be found in the parent property manager for the override named '#propertyName#' in module '#getAppManager().getModuleName()#'." />
</cfif>
<cfset setProperty(propertyName, getParent().getProperty(mapping), arguments.override) />
</cfif>
<cfelse>
<cfif StructKeyExists(propertyNodes[i].xmlAttributes, "type")>
<cfset propertyType = propertyNodes[i].xmlAttributes["type"] />
<cfset propertyParams = StructNew() />
<cfif StructKeyExists(propertyNodes[i], "parameters")>
<cfset paramsNodes = propertyNodes[i].parameters.xmlChildren />
<cfloop from="1" to="#ArrayLen(paramsNodes)#" index="j">
<cfset paramName = paramsNodes[j].XmlAttributes["name"] />
<cftry>
<cfset paramValue = variables.utils.recurseComplexValues(paramsNodes[j]) />
<cfcatch type="any">
<cfthrow type="MachII.framework.InvalidPropertyXml"
message="Xml parsing error for the property named '#propertyName#' in module named '#getAppManager().getModuleName()#'." />
</cfcatch>
</cftry>
<cfset propertyParams[paramName] = paramValue />
</cfloop>
</cfif>
<cftry>
<cfset propertyValue = CreateObject("component", propertyType) />
<cfset propertyValue.init(getAppManager(), propertyParams) />
<cfcatch type="any">
<cfif StructKeyExists(cfcatch, "missingFileName")>
<cfthrow type="MachII.framework.CannotFindProperty"
message="Cannot find a CFC with the type of '#propertyType#' for the property named '#propertyName#' in module named '#getAppManager().getModuleName()#'."
detail="Please check that a property exists and that there is not a misconfiguration in the XML configuration file.">
<cfelse>
<cfrethrow />
</cfif>
</cfcatch>
</cftry>
<cfset ArrayAppend(variables.configurableProperties, propertyName) />
<cfelse>
<cftry>
<cfset propertyValue = variables.utils.recurseComplexValues(propertyNodes[i]) />
<cfcatch type="any">
<cfthrow type="MachII.framework.InvalidPropertyXml"
message="Xml parsing error for the property named '#propertyName#' in module '#getAppManager().getModuleName()#'." />
</cfcatch>
</cftry>
</cfif>
<cfif (hasParent AND NOT listFindNoCase(propsNotAllowInModule, propertyName))
OR NOT hasParent>
<cfset setProperty(propertyName, propertyValue) />
</cfif>
</cfif>
</cfloop>
<cfif NOT hasParent>
<cfif NOT isPropertyDefined("defaultEvent")>
<cfset setProperty("defaultEvent", "defaultEvent") />
</cfif>
<cfif NOT isPropertyDefined("exceptionEvent")>
<cfset setProperty("exceptionEvent", "exceptionEvent") />
</cfif>
<cfif NOT isPropertyDefined("applicationRoot")>
<cfset setProperty("applicationRoot", "") />
</cfif>
<cfif NOT isPropertyDefined("eventParameter")>
<cfset setProperty("eventParameter", "event") />
</cfif>
<cfif NOT isPropertyDefined("parameterPrecedence")>
<cfset setProperty("parameterPrecedence", "form") />
<cfelseif NOT ListFindNoCase("form|url", getProperty("parameterPrecedence"), "|")>
<cfthrow type="MachII.framework.invalidPropertyValue"
message="The 'parameterPrecedence' property must have a the value of 'form' or 'url'." />
</cfif>
<cfif NOT isPropertyDefined("maxEvents")>
<cfset setProperty("maxEvents", 10) />
<cfelseif NOT IsNumeric(getProperty("maxEvents"))>
<cfthrow type="MachII.framework.invalidPropertyValue"
message="The 'maxEvents' property must be an integer." />
</cfif>
<cfif NOT isPropertyDefined("redirectPersistParameter")>
<cfset setProperty("redirectPersistParameter", "persistId") />
</cfif>
<cfif NOT isPropertyDefined("redirectPersistScope")>
<cfset setProperty("redirectPersistScope", "session") />
</cfif>
<cfif NOT isPropertyDefined("urlBase")>
<cfset setProperty("urlBase", "index.cfm") />
</cfif>
<cfif NOT isPropertyDefined("urlDelimiters")>
<cfset setProperty("urlDelimiters", "?|&|=") />
<cfelseif ListLen(getProperty("urlDelimiters"), "|") NEQ 3>
<cfthrow type="MachII.framework.invalidPropertyValue"
message="The 'urlDelimiters' property must have a list length of 3 with a delimiter of a '|'." />
</cfif>
<cfif NOT isPropertyDefined("urlParseSES")>
<cfset setProperty("urlParseSES", false) />
<cfelseif NOT IsBoolean(getProperty("urlParseSES"))>
<cfthrow type="MachII.framework.invalidPropertyValue"
message="The 'urlParseSES' property must be a boolean." />
</cfif>
<cfif NOT isPropertyDefined("moduleDelimiter")>
<cfset setProperty("moduleDelimiter", ":") />
</cfif>
</cfif>
</cffunction>
